Welcome to London and welcome to City Sightseeing & The Original Tour. We provide more than just a great way to travel around the capital, founded nearly 60 years ago at the time of The Festival of Britain and now the largest and most popular sightseeing operator in the world.
The City Sightseeing & Original Tours have become established as THE essential introduction to London. We invite you to experience all the magical sights and sounds of London in a comfortable and secure environment.

Includes 3 free walking tours - Changing of the Guard (10.30 from the Original London Visitor Centre, Trafalgar Square), Rock n' Roll (13.00 from the Orignal London Visitor Centre) and Jack the Ripper (15.30 from our stop at Tower of London/Tower Hill). Also includes free Thames river cruise

Tour: City Sightseeing London Original Tour
Start Point: Red Route: Haymarket in Piccadilly Circus
Yellow route: Whitcomb Street in Piccadilly Circus
Blue route: Kensington Palace Gate & Woburn Place

Please Note: E-tickets must be validated at the Original London Visitor Centre, Trafalgar Square before taking the tour.

Duration: 130 minutes each route
Frequency: 10 - 20 minutes
Season: All Year round daily except 25th Dec 2010
Ticket Validity: 24 hours from 1st March 2010 - 31st October 2010
Commentary: Red & Blue routes: Pre-recorded English, French, German
Italian, Spanish, Japanese, Russian
Kid's Commentary (Red route only).
Yellow route: English Live Guide

Wheelchair Accessible on some tour buses
Child (5-15yrs): £12.00
Adult: £25.00
